Bringing Dependents
F-1 and J-1 students often desire to bring their dependents (as defined by the USCIS or DHS, the spouses or unmarried minor children of F-1 or J-1 students) to the U.S. to join them while they are completing their degrees.

Application Procedure:
- Contact OISS to request a Dependent SEVIS DS-2019 and provide the following:
        1. Copy of passport ID page 
        2. Proof of financial support in the amount of $4000/dependent
        3. Personal data
                    a. First Name
                    b. Middle Name
                    c. Last Name
                    d. Place of birth (city, country)
                    e. Country of citizenship
                    f. Relationship to student
                    g. Gender

- Request a letter of support from the OISS addressed to the visa-issuing officer in support of the visa application for the dependent. The letter should include the personal identification information for each dependent mentioned above.

- Print the dependent visa checklist (coming soon!) for additional supporting documentation recommendations

- Schedule an appointment at the US Consulate/Embassy to apply for the F-2 or J-2 visa

Inviting Family & Friends
Students wishing to invite family and friends to come for a short visit may want to contact OISS to request an Invitation Letter of Support. A family member or friend often needs a letter from our office for the US Consulate or Embassy to apply for a visitor’s visa to come and visit. Your request is only accepted via email accompanied by an invitation letter request form. A separate letter will be issued for each guest.

Immigration Requirements
F-2 Immigration Regulations
Insurance Requirementsall dependents are required to have health insurance for their duration of stay, including medical evacuation and repatriation
Taxes – If claiming your dependents on your tax return, you will most likely need to request an ITIN for them if they are not eligible for an SSN.
